Join Nate and his daughter Junebug as they watch and discuss the great movies of the early Blockbuster Era of filmmaking. Reminisce as they relive "Off-Set Significant Events" that occurred the same year that the movie of each episode was released. Learn more about the art of filmmaking behind the scenes with "People that Make it Possible." Discover fun and exciting trivia with "Retro Flicks Fun Facts." Follow the careers of the stars in "Where Are They Now?" And don't forget to bring your appetite for "My Kid Ransacks the Movie Snacks." Jampacked with so much retro fun, each episode will leave you asking, "Was this movie made in the 1900s?"

Episode 2: Flight of the Navigator
Nate and Junebug sit down to discuss the 1986 retro classic, "Flight of the Navigator." They rate the unique sunflower seeds they ate while watching the movie in "My Kid Ransacks the Movie Snacks." On the topic of UFOs, they relive the disaster surrounding "Balloonfest '86" and other news stories of 1986 in "Off-Set Significant Events." They swap interesting facts in "Retro Flicks Fun Facts" and Junebug teaches us about jobs in movie making in "People That Make It Possible." So, come along, Flick-Pickers! We've got a podcast guaranteed to make you ask, "Was this movie made in the 1900s?" Episode 1: The Goonies
Nate and Junebug sit down to discuss the 1985 retro classic, "The Goonies." They rate the unique soda they drank while watching the movie in "My Kid Ransacks the Movie Snacks." Speaking of soda, they relive the controversy surrounding the creation of New Coke and other news stories of 1985 in "Off-Set Significant Events." They swap interesting facts in "Retro Flicks Fun Facts" and Nate amazes Junebug with "Where Are They Now?" So, come along, Flick-Pickers! We've got a podcast guaranteed to make you ask, "Was this movie made in the 1900s?"
